Hello~I came across your site last night, a link from mrs catherines
website. Anyway, I am putting a household binder together, and just loved
yours. Especially the links to the pictures that you use. But I was wondering
if you could tell me alittle more about how you plan out the whole 40 weeks for
homeschooling ahead.? We also homeschool, but the most I get planned out at a
time is about 12 weeks, I would love to get the whole year done. I plan for 4
days a week.
I would love to hear back from you. Thanks so much~D******
Answer:
Thank you for your comments!
I just made the schedule you saw for my son recently, after seeing Miss Maggie's on her Homeschool Curriculum page.
It's wonderful and so helpful to help me remember to have him do all his regular work every day. The schedule provides structure for me....I am not naturally a structured person.
You can see Miss Maggies' first grade schedule here , and the FREE entire curriculum for the first grade here. This is not the exact curriculum I go by...I have so many books here at home that I have been fortunate enough to be given by friends and family...however I do use many of the resources on her Homeschool books page for extra learning. There are some WONDERFUL resources there!
Now if you'd like to design your own schedule for school, you can use this template which is what I used for my children's schedules...this is in Microsoft Word:
Schedule
This is what my son's looks like:
Caleb's routines
After I print this same sheet out about 6 times, I get a calendar, and I mark the weeks in the left hand corner...that way I can mark off the row he has completed each time.
Example:
(Week) 1
9/14-9/21
Then I put the pages in the laminated sheets and put them to good use!
